Rep. Byron Donalds (R-Fla.), the Republican nominee for Florida governor, announced Sunday that he is collaborating with leaders in Haiti to help stabilize the country's government.
This diplomatic effort follows the expiration of temporary protected status (TPS) for over 300,000 Haitian migrants living in the United States. Donalds stated that he has already held meetings regarding the transitional situation.
